特牛网址导航

Spring-boot RestTemplate使用过程中返回结果不是200的异常处理_后端接口返回不是200 铁道-CSDN博客

网友收藏
文章浏览阅读1.5k次。使用RestTemplate过程中, 如果接口返回的不是200状态,则会抛出异常报错。但在实际接口对接中,可能希望获取接口返回的异常信息做返回。因此可以自定义RestTemplate异常的处理,在使用之前首先添加异常处理,如下:第一种 : restTemplate.setErrorHandler(new ResponseErrorHandler(){ @Override public boolean hasError(ClientHttpResponse_后端接口返回不是200 铁道